Movie #1412 "Blade Runner 2049" - mixed feelings about this one. Heavy duty sci fi with a worthwhile theme (how can we be human in such a technological world?) but very very very s-l-o-w in pacing. I didn't mind it too much because I enjoy watching Ryan Gosling walking around such beautiful sets, but I can see how some people would mind. I always think he is a cerebral actor who makes me constantly wonder what he is thinking --- therefore, he comes across as more of a complex character in comparison to some of his contemporaries..... But then, again, I have always found him fascinating since I saw him way back in "Lars and the real girl." Story here is a bit thin, and parts of it you can guess before they happen (well, like I said, you have a lot of time!) But all of this pales to how sumptuous the set is in this film ---- wow! The sets/environment are very rich and complex. So if you want to see a movie that has great sets, a slow story, but continues the saga that blade runner #1 started, this is a movie you need to see. And then there's the Ryan Gosling factor......
"BLADE RUNNER: 2049" R 2017
Thirty years after the events of the first film, a new blade runner, LAPD Officer K (Ryan Gosling), unearths a long buried secret that has the potential to plunge what's left of society into chaos. K's discovery leads him on a quest to find Rick Deckard (Harrison Ford), a former LAPD blade runner who has been missing for 30 years.
